#### Accepting New Clients Areas of Focus- Anxiety & Stress, Depression, Trauma & Intergenerational Patterns, Cultural Identity & Belonging, Burnout & Academic Pressure, Life Transitions & Self-Esteem, Emotion Regulation, BIPOC Mental Health, Crisis Support Therapeutic Modalities: Gottman Method of Couples Therapy (Level 1 & 2) Cognitive Behavioral Therapy (CBT) Dialectical Behavior Therapy (DBT) Narrative Therapy Solution-Focused Therapy (SFT) Acceptance & Commitment Therapy (ACT) Trauma-Informed & Anti-Oppressive Practices Languages spoken-English Ashmi Sharma, MSW, RSW (she/her) is a Registered Social Worker who supports teens (14+), adults, and couples navigating anxiety, relationship stress, identity exploration, burnout, and trauma. Her approach is relational, trauma-informed, and culturally responsive, with a deep understanding of the challenges faced by BIPOC and first-generation clients. Ashmi integrates CBT, DBT, ACT, Narrative Therapy, and the Gottman Method (Level 1 & 2) to meet each client’s unique needs. Whether you’re working through intergenerational pressure, emotional disconnection, or a difficult life transition, Ashmi offers a warm, non-judgmental space where healing can begin. Couples, Adults, Teens (14+)
